Mageia aufhübschen (Dandifying Mageia)
Im englischen Mageia-Blog ist am 04.09.2016 eine - im ersten Anlauf für Entwickler interessante - Meldung erschienen. (https://blog.mageia.org/en/2016/09/04/dandifying-mageia/).
Dort wird darüber berichtet, dass (unter Einsatz von ziemlich viel Arbeit), das Fedora-Werkzeug DNF unter Mageia6 lauffähig gemacht wurde. DNF erledigt unter Fedora/RedHat/CentOS das, was urpmi unter Mageia tut: Wenn Programme installiert werden, sorgt es dafür, dass alle Pakete, die diese Programme benötigen mit installiert werden. Darüber hinaus verwaltet es die Aktualisierung des Systems.
Dieser mögliche Einsatz von DNF unter Mageia, erlaubt es nun, die Distribution Mageia als mögliches Ziel für das Herstellen von Paketen in MOCK einzubinden. Was ist nun MOCK? Es erledigt den Job im RedHat-Universum, den rpmbuild bei Mageia tut.
Was interessiert das den einfachen Benutzer?
Nun, es ermöglicht Entwicklern - so die Zielvorstellung - die Pakete für RedHat und Co. erstellen, auf Knopfdruck gleich welche für Mageia mit zu erzeugen. Und dies, ohne vorher eine andere Distribution starten und mit "fremden" Werkzeugen hantieren zu müssen. Die damit verbundene Hoffnung ist natürlich, dass so Pakete für Mageia entstehen, die es sonst nur für RedHat und Co. gäbe und welche sich (wie hier schon einige leidvoll erfahren haben) nur mit Verrenkungen unter Mageia installieren lassen.
Außerdem gibt es einige Werkzeuge, z.B. Spacewalk und Katello für das Paketmanagement in größeren Installationen, die mit DNF auch unter Mageia nutzbar werden.
Also dient das Projekt insgesamt dem Ziel. mehr Software unter Mageia verfügbar zu machen, ohne alles selber anpassen zu müssen.
Dort wird darüber berichtet, dass (unter Einsatz von ziemlich viel Arbeit), das Fedora-Werkzeug DNF unter Mageia6 lauffähig gemacht wurde. DNF erledigt unter Fedora/RedHat/CentOS das, was urpmi unter Mageia tut: Wenn Programme installiert werden, sorgt es dafür, dass alle Pakete, die diese Programme benötigen mit installiert werden. Darüber hinaus verwaltet es die Aktualisierung des Systems.
Dieser mögliche Einsatz von DNF unter Mageia, erlaubt es nun, die Distribution Mageia als mögliches Ziel für das Herstellen von Paketen in MOCK einzubinden. Was ist nun MOCK? Es erledigt den Job im RedHat-Universum, den rpmbuild bei Mageia tut.
Was interessiert das den einfachen Benutzer?
Nun, es ermöglicht Entwicklern - so die Zielvorstellung - die Pakete für RedHat und Co. erstellen, auf Knopfdruck gleich welche für Mageia mit zu erzeugen. Und dies, ohne vorher eine andere Distribution starten und mit "fremden" Werkzeugen hantieren zu müssen. Die damit verbundene Hoffnung ist natürlich, dass so Pakete für Mageia entstehen, die es sonst nur für RedHat und Co. gäbe und welche sich (wie hier schon einige leidvoll erfahren haben) nur mit Verrenkungen unter Mageia installieren lassen.
Außerdem gibt es einige Werkzeuge, z.B. Spacewalk und Katello für das Paketmanagement in größeren Installationen, die mit DNF auch unter Mageia nutzbar werden.
Also dient das Projekt insgesamt dem Ziel. mehr Software unter Mageia verfügbar zu machen, ohne alles selber anpassen zu müssen.